Comment mettre GitHub sur son CV

Mona Minaie
Auteur
Découvrez quand ajouter GitHub à votre CV, où placer le lien et quels dépôts mettre en avant pour une candidature technique.
Comment mettre GitHub sur son CV
Si vous visez un poste en logiciel, data, DevOps ou un autre métier technique, ajoutez GitHub sur votre CV seulement si le lien prouve des compétences demandées par l'offre. Le plus simple est de mettre votre profil principal dans l'en-tête, puis un ou deux dépôts solides dans la section Projets ou Expérience. En revanche, laissez GitHub de côté si le compte est vide, daté ou composé surtout de code privé.
Quand GitHub a sa place sur un CV
GitHub est utile quand le recruteur s'attend à voir du code, des projets techniques ou des traces de collaboration. C'est souvent le cas pour :
- Le développement logiciel, web ou mobile, le DevOps, la data, le machine learning et l'automatisation QA.
- Les étudiants, jeunes diplômés et profils en reconversion qui doivent appuyer leur candidature avec des projets.
- Les candidats ayant des contributions open source, des side projects, des démos techniques ou de la documentation technique.
Pour un poste non technique, GitHub n'a généralement pas besoin d'être mis en avant.
Où placer GitHub sur le CV
Le bon emplacement dépend de ce que le lien doit démontrer.
1. Dans l'en-tête
C'est le choix le plus simple : le lien est visible tout de suite sans casser la lecture du CV.
Exemple
Jordan Lee
github.com/jordanlee | linkedin.com/in/jordanlee | jordanlee.dev
Privilégiez une URL propre ou un nom d'utilisateur professionnel. Évitez les liens longs ou inutiles.
2. Dans la section Projets
C'est l'option la plus forte lorsqu'un projet correspond clairement au poste visé.
Exemple
Tableau de bord de prévision des stocks | Python, FastAPI, React
github.com/jordanlee/inventory-dashboard
- Conçu un outil qui importe des ventes CSV et visualise les tendances par catégorie de produit.
- Rédigé les endpoints, les tests et la documentation d'installation pour qu'un autre développeur puisse lancer le projet en local.
Mieux vaut un projet fort et pertinent que plusieurs dépôts faibles.
3. Dans l'expérience professionnelle
Si GitHub faisait partie de votre travail, stage, recherche ou mission freelance, mentionnez-le dans une puce plutôt que d'ajouter un lien isolé.
Exemple
- Maintenu des services Python internes sur GitHub, relu des pull requests et documenté les étapes de déploiement pour l'équipe support.
Cette approche montre la collaboration, le contrôle de version et la responsabilité sur un travail réellement livré.
Ce que le recruteur doit voir après le clic
GitHub aide seulement si le profil est facile à évaluer. Avant d'ajouter le lien, vérifiez que votre profil montre :
- Une bio courte cohérente avec le type de poste recherché.
- Des dépôts épinglés qui représentent votre travail le plus fort et le plus pertinent.
- Des README qui expliquent l'objectif du projet, son lancement et votre contribution.
- Des noms clairs, une activité suffisamment récente et aucun lien de démo cassé.
- Du code public que vous avez réellement le droit de partager.
Vous n'avez pas besoin de commits quotidiens. Vous avez besoin d'un profil qui semble réfléchi et soigné.
Erreurs fréquentes
- Lier un profil vide ou un dépôt sans README.
- Envoyer le recruteur vers de vieux exercices de cours qui ne reflètent plus votre niveau.
- Présenter GitHub comme une compétence au lieu de montrer vos compétences via les projets.
- Lier du code confidentiel ou un travail que vous n'êtes pas autorisé à publier.
- Ajouter trop de dépôts et laisser le lecteur deviner ce qui compte.
Quand il vaut mieux ne pas mettre GitHub
Oui, parfois il vaut mieux s'abstenir. Si le compte est faible, peu actif ou sans rapport avec le poste, un bon CV, un résumé de projets ou un site personnel vous aidera davantage qu'un lien peu convaincant.
FAQ
Faut-il mettre GitHub dans la rubrique compétences ?
En général non. GitHub sert surtout à montrer le contrôle de version, la collaboration et le travail technique sur des projets.
Un seul projet GitHub peut-il suffire ?
Oui. Un projet clair, pertinent et bien documenté vaut souvent plus que plusieurs dépôts inachevés.
GitHub peut-il remplacer un portfolio ?
Pour beaucoup de profils techniques, oui pour la partie preuve de projets. Si vous avez aussi besoin de cas d'usage, de visuels ou de contexte produit, un site personnel reste utile.

